■Summary

The MP2650 is a highly integrated buck or boost charger IC with narrow voltage DC (NVDC) power path management and USB OTG (On-The-Go). MP2760 is designed for battery packs with 2 to 4 cells connected in series. All power MOSFETs are integrated, providing a compact system solution size. The IC has a wide input voltage (VIN) range for charging, supporting up to 21V VIN. The MP2650 has two operating modes during the powering process, boost powering mode and buck powering mode, depending on VIN and number of cells. Using the I2C interface, the MP2650 allows flexible configuration of boost, buck, and OTG mode parameters. Parameters include input current limit (IIN_LIM), VIN limit (VIN_LIM), charge current (ICHARGE), battery charge voltage regulation (VBATT_REG), and safe power transfer timer. I2C can also provide operational status of the IC through fault and status registers. To ensure safe operation, the IC limits the die temperature to a preset value of 120°C. Other safety features include input overvoltage protection (OVP), battery OVP, system OVP, thermal shutdown, battery temperature protection, and a programmed timer to prevent long-term charging of a dead battery. To comply with the IMVP8 specification, the IC has three analog output pins for system power (PSYS), input current (IAM), and battery current (IBM). There is also a processor hot indication pin (PROCHOT) for system power control. NVDC power path management adjusts the system voltage (VSYS) within a narrow DC width to provide an optimized bus voltage (VBUS) for the system bus rails. This allows the system to operate even if the battery is completely depleted or removed. The MP2650 is offered in a QFN-30 (4mm x 5mm) package.
